What is a Certified Door Installer?
A certified door installer has actually gone through specific training and assessment to show their proficiency in door installation. Accreditation may come from makers, market associations, or trade organizations that ensure the installer complies with acknowledged requirements in workmanship and safety. These professionals are geared up to handle various kinds of doors, including residential, commercial, and specialized choices such as fire-rated and hurricane-resistant doors.

Comprehending the steps involved in door installation can help property owners appreciate the skill needed from certified installers. Here is an introduction of the typical door installation procedure:
Assessment and Measurement
Examine the existing door frame, measurements, and any required repair work.Discuss the wanted door type, style, and material with the property owner.
Preparing the Site
Eliminate the old door and frame, if needed, while making sure the surrounding location is protected.Conduct any required repair work to the frame or structure.
Installation
Install the door frame if it's a new door.Position the door properly in the frame, ensuring it is level and plumb.Secure the door with hinges and check its operation.
Finishing Touches

To help with awareness, here's a breakdown of popular door types that certified installers frequently deal with:
